Output 661ff7dc5e3677be13c68c1e7053e8a974fc5ba4a2dfab540255b3404db4ae5e: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 108f37f57007fc0b27b81a4bd49ac6262b518e43 OP_EQUAL
address
33CaJcdGNXRFJRw7B2YXTZd8vki1QHGBfe
transaction
661ff7dc5e3677be13c68c1e7053e8a974fc5ba4a2dfab540255b3404db4ae5e
spent
true